Around the country and in New Mexico there is a growing trend of grandparents becoming primary caregivers for their grandchildren. This happens when a parent becomes ill or dies. Sometimes parents are incarcerated. And it often happens when parents fall into addiction or struggle with mental health issues.
Grandparents can provide a stable home for children coming from these chaotic situations. But many are over the age of 60 and they’re often unprepared for the challenges of being parents again, especially when their grandchildren may be dealing with trauma. They face financial burdens and legal difficulties. And they often neglect their own health needs to focus on their grandchildren.
What can New Mexico do to support these grandparents and ensure these children thrive?
